In a recent tweet, Cardano founder Charles Hoskinson reacted to recent progress made as a number of treasury proposals got approved by the Cardano community. Hoskinson reacted to the information that four of the ADA treasury proposals from Input Output Group to improve Cardano have been approved by the Cardano community by saying, "keep pushing."

— Charles Hoskinson (@IOHK\_Charles) May 23, 2026 This response follows a setback earlier in the week when some Japanese dReps voted against Input Output Group's research proposal. On a positive note for the network, a number of Cardano upgrades have crossed the DRep approval threshold. These include CIP-159 Account Address Enhancement, Multi-Asset Treasury CIP and Native Babel Fees. CIP-159 Account Address Enhancement allows enhanced account addresses to introduce semi-Ethereum-like accounts, opening the door to microfees and new use cases. The multi-asset treasury CIP will allow project funding in stable currencies for better budgeting and planning. Babel Fees allow bridging to Cardano and transactions in native currency to be seamless.
According to a recent Intersect update, the van Rossem upgrade program continues progressing through staged rollout activities. Coordination efforts remain focused on minimizing disruption while maintaining ecosystem stability and integration confidence ahead of Mainnet governance actions. The Node v11.0.1 remains the mandatory upgrade path for infrastructure providers to successfully transition through the Protocol Version 11 hard fork boundary. In this light, a crucial notice has been passed to Cardano node operators. Cardano SPO Samuel Leathers shared a notice on X in this regard. Discussions this week focused on a recently identified and resolved DB-Sync issue affecting synchronization stability under certain upgrade scenarios. While compatibility with node v11.0.1 remains in place, additional validation and soak time were deemed necessary before progressing further with the hard fork rollout. The Plutus Cost model parameter update governance action is due to be submitted on mainnet on May 22. Cardano has surpassed 121 million transactions on mainnet, achieving a fresh milestone.
